More about Permaculture courses
Exploring Permaculture courses in Bathurst is an excellent step toward gaining practical skills in sustainable agriculture. Located in the heart of New South Wales, Bathurst offers aspiring permaculturists the opportunity to learn from recognised training organisations (RTOs) that provide a comprehensive education in permaculture principles. The two available courses, including the Certificate II in Horticulture AHC20422 and the Certificate III in Parks and Gardens AHC31021, are designed for beginners looking to cultivate their understanding of ecological farming techniques and sustainable land use.
These courses lead to various job roles in the agricultural sector, such as garden supervisor, horticulturalist, or sustainable agriculture consultant, allowing you to engage with local environmental initiatives in Bathurst. Moreover, students can explore specific study areas like Livestock and Animal Production, Winemaking, and Beekeeping. By studying in these diverse fields, learners can develop a well-rounded knowledge of agricultural practices that not only benefit individual career prospects but also contribute positively to the local community's sustainability efforts.
Enrolling in a permaculture course in Bathurst is an investment in your future as you gain essential skills while supporting the region's ecological practices. The knowledge acquired from these courses will empower you to play a crucial role in local agriculture, whether through enhancing soil health or learning effective water management techniques.
